The reason why the meter postage does not work as you have shown is because there is a post mark date which indicated the mailing date. If it is mailed after that date technically it is void. If some of you are fortunate enough to have access to a postage meter you can program it to do the postage but leave off the date. When it hits to Post Office they will place their post mark stamp on it to show the mail date. Just thought I would share, Quote Share this post Link to post Share on other sites
